A Guide to Selling Property Privately in Spain

The first direction of action if selling privately is to decide how a great deal to promote for. This will be the spine of your promoting strategy. In other words, if you ask too much for your own home, human beings will no longer even hassle viewing it and could opt to buy via property retailers. Ask too little for your own home, and you are probably giving away a part of your property! The right asking rate is perhaps the maximum essential component within the art of selling your house privately and is the result of thorough market research. Don’t accept the figure you want to pay attention to; discover the proper marketplace fee. What were comparable houses bought for? And what other owners with similar houses are asking? If your own home is precise, this may let you ask for a higher asking price because it can’t effortlessly be reproduced?

The maximum experienced sellers will offer a precious source of marketplace records and will help you reach an end as to a proper valuation and an accurate asking rate for your own home. At the give up of the day, you must be convinced that you are asking as an awful lot as you probably can while attracting shoppers. You must consider the amount you are saving via promoting your home privately and take sufficient of this off your asking price to make your house attractive to buyers. However, you have to also think about advertising costs, e.g., in papers and on websites, although this ought to be in the loads instead of the hundreds most effectively. An asking fee isn’t always necessarily the income fee at the cease of the day. Therefore, the clever seller must also bear in mind constructing an inexpensive margin for negotiation into their asking fee.

However, remember that if you do not take enough off, you definately should be prepared for plenty less hobby from both prospective buyers, ensuing in fewer showings of the belongings and a ready sport.

Beware of dealers who let you know you need to pay attention to too many dealers purposely overvalue homes to get a list and let their dealers down over time. Consequently, too many overpriced properties are on the market, sitting there without viewings while the seller has assumed that the asking price became reasonable.

Providing market conditions is beneficial, and there’s an abundance of clients looking for property much like yours. A successful income strategy needs to bring about a minimum of two or more showings in line with a month. Finding a client is, in many respects, simply a numbers game: the extra individuals who view the belongings, the greater probability that one of them will fall in love with it and put in a proposal. Some consumers will negotiate with you, and others may be less difficult. But it’s simpler to refuse a low provide in case you are displaying your house frequently.

Originally, The Art of The Deal I check with become about the apartment income, much less the loan costs and every other expense, and something becomes left need to were profit on the give up of every month.

The profit is then extended by 12 (as inside the 12 months) and divided via my preliminary funding. This is your Return on Investment (ROI). This became the way to examine one asset deal, in opposition to some other deal, particularly at distinctive rental values.

For example, is a belonging purchased at £150k with a lease of £650, as excellent as a deal at £95k and a condo value of £425. Do the solution? You need to recognize the service price on everyone, then upload inside the property management expenses. Then you could do your evaluation. Usually, it’s the lower charge residences that provide a higher go back on funding. A bonus of a lower-priced property is also that you do not need to pay stamp responsibility.

As properly as having a better go back on funding, having smaller homes in one huge property helps with void intervals. If one in your two smaller homes is empty, then it’s most effective a 50% void. But having the only massive property empty method is one hundred% void.

In fact, while you’re first beginning out in property investing, there is a line of the notion that suggests you have to handiest buy residences under the £120k mark that allows you to keep away from stamp responsibility and to unfold the danger across a couple of houses, which takes benefit of a better Return, much less hazard in terms of voids, much less up the front expenses (even though you may have mortgage costs and two sets of solicitors expenses).
